>> For me, I've basically dropped HotCocoa. After doing a few apps with it I quickly came to realize that I liked IB and building apps that way. The thing that I've missed from HotCocoa is all the little Ruby-ish extensions that it added to various classes. As I've built other apps I've been collecting up a few of those and decided to stuff them into a gem.

> Here's one I use a lot. Feel free to add it.
>
> class NSIndexSet
> include Enumerable
>
> def each
> i = self.firstIndex
> until i == NSNotFound
> yield i
> i = self.indexGreaterThanIndex(i)
> end
> end
>
> end
